Before COVID-19, your dental team would wash their hands, put on new gloves and a mask, and then start your appointment. With the new challenges posed by COVID-19, some changes have been made to ensure that patients and staff remain safe and protected from the spread of the virus. As you continue reading, you’ll learn about some of the new measures your dentist in Dublin is taking so that you can feel comfortable at your next visit!

High Standards Maintained for Your Safety

Historically, dentists have been at the forefront of preventing the spread of infection because of the very stringent rules they’ve always followed for cleanliness. However, the unique threat posed by COVID-19 has required dentists to make even more accommodations. As a result, you can feel secure that when you visit, you’re in a safe environment.

Here are some of the ways practices are stepping up their efforts:

Safety Champion

Your dentist will designate a staff member as Safety Champion, whose job it will be to ensure that each person in the office is following the guidelines and standards necessary for maintaining a safe environment and preventing the spread of COVID-19.

Daily Health Checks of Staff

Each day, staff members will have their temperature checked and will answer a quick set of questions to ensure that the entire team is able to provide safe dental care. Therefore, you won’t have to worry about any threats to your health.

Change Work Clothes at Work Policy

Before leaving work and intermingling with other people in their communities, dental staff will change clothes at work to prevent any spreading of germs and bacteria. This serves as an added means of protection for their families and the people of the surrounding areas, and helps to flatten the COVID-19 curve.

Personal Protective Equipment (PPE)

You may notice the staff at your dentist’s office wearing the following PPE:

  • Face shields
  • Shoe coverings
  • Front desk masks
  • Disposable, protective coats and hats

In-Depth Staff Planning

Because it’s important for everyone to be on the same page, most practices are holding daily planning meetings. This provides an opportunity to keep the entire team up-to-speed with the safety protocols of the office and to discuss any areas where improvements can be made.
